About Clair

Clair Fulton is a qualified and registered therapist based in the United Kingdom who offers a supportive, nonjudgmental space for people to explore their thoughts, feelings, and life experiences. She approaches therapy with respect for the individual, working from the belief that each person is the expert on their own life while using her skills to help facilitate insight and change. Clair holds professional counselling credentials - BACP and NCPS - which indicate formal training and registration in counselling and psychotherapy.

She is comfortable working with both adults and children and young people, and has substantial experience delivering therapy face to face as well as remotely via video calls, telephone, and live chat. In private practice she works with adult clients, and she also provides counselling within a local authority setting focused on education and early intervention for 11 to 25 year olds, offering support in schools, therapy rooms, and online. In addition, she teaches counselling to trainee practitioners at a higher education college.

Her background includes several years supporting children and young people in residential and foster care, care leavers, and staff in health and social care settings. Clair is experienced supporting people affected by early life trauma, attachment difficulties, behavioural and learning challenges, and a wide range of adult concerns including grief, depression, anxiety, relationship difficulties, identity and LGBTQIA+ issues, and major life changes. She has also completed targeted training to support people within the skateboarding community. Clair describes it as a privilege to accompany people on their journeys toward change and growth, and she welcomes enquiries to discuss potential ways of working together.

Client-Centered and CBT Approaches Delivered Online

Clair uses client-centered therapy to prioritize the individual’s perspective, offering empathetic listening and support that helps people explore values, identity, and relationships in a way that feels personally meaningful. This approach is often helpful for concerns around self-esteem, life transitions, intimacy, and identity-related issues.

She also draws on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), a practical, goal-focused method that helps identify and shift unhelpful thinking and behavior patterns. CBT can be effective for managing anxiety, depression, stress, sleep and eating difficulties, and many common day-to-day challenges.

Finding the right therapeutic approach is part of the process, and Clair works collaboratively to determine what best suits each person’s needs, goals, and preferences. She adapts methods over time when necessary so therapy remains relevant and effective for the individual.
